Dos Madres press, 2015<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>Reviewed by Wendy French.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><em>Best Man<\/em>\u00a0has just been awarded\u00a0first prize in the Jean Pedrick Chapbook prize from the New England Poetry Club. When you read the poems you can certainly understand why Lewis&#8217;s work\u00a0has received this recognition.<\/p>\n<p>Edward Hirsch&#8217;s epigraph features at the beginning\u00a0of the collection\u00a0and is entirely apt for all that follows:<\/p>\n<p><em>Look closely and you will see<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Almost everyone carrying bags<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Of cement on their shoulders.<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>How universally true this is. Although our bags of cement may be entirely different from the ones\u00a0that Lewis carries, they are nevertheless present. It is for this very reason that <em>Best Man <\/em>can speak to each and all its readers.<\/p>\n<p>The poems focus on\u00a0anger, regret, failure and love. They are about all that it is to be human, and specifically to love a brother in a hopeless situation.<\/p>\n<p>In the collection, each of the poems stands alone, but together they tell a story of dependency, support, and of the\u00a0fight against a\u00a0battle with drugs and addiction. The story needed to be told. I read the book as a single unit from beginning to end, as the poems together record a\u00a0 young man\u2019s life and were written from the standpoint of\u00a0despair. Once I started reading, I felt compelled\u00a0to finish. Lewis truly captures the pain and anger that he, an older brother, felt towards his sibling who was, as well as destroying his own life, destroying that of his parents, his grandmother, indeed his\u00a0entire\u00a0family. I was totally engrossed in the unfolding narrative\u00a0and desperate to find out\u00a0how it would all end. In each of the poems there is a level of intensity that drives the words forward and into\u00a0the next poem.<\/p>\n<p>The collection opens with <em>Post-script, Unwritten Letter<\/em> where\u00a0Lewis looks back over childhood and the familiar games that children play:<\/p>\n<p><em>\u2018\u2026 like the children we were<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>digging through the backyard soil, determined to get to China,<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0 The spot under the swings<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>where our feet whisked the ground before each pendulum soar\u2026\u2019 <\/em><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>These lines determine the relationship between two boys. The poem ends:<\/p>\n<p><em>\u2018Wherever you\u2019ve been you\u2019ll have something to tell me. I expected <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0 \u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0to know more.\u2019 <\/em><\/p>\n<p>I had to re-read these lines as that situation, where we have lost friends and want to know more of their lives, is so familiar. Tragically for Lewis, the loss is that of\u00a0his\u00a0brother, whose\u00a0full story will never be known. How did this fall into addiction begin?<\/p>\n<p>This was a brave book to write and it took Lewis thirty years to be able to tackle the content.\u00a0Lewis is not afraid to be truthful:<\/p>\n<p><em>I am still mad at you.<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Every week another call<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>from a burnt-out Bronx <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>neighbourhood,\u00a0 or Brooklyn\u2026 <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u2026our grandmother told me you were ok.<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>She cooked you a pair of fried eggs.\u00a0 <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>The very fact of a grandmother feeding her grandson, hoping that this might bring him back to his senses, reveals a\u00a0family pulling together and trying to overcome the situation. When you care for a loved one, you believe that food conquers distress. We all at times clutch at straws.<\/p>\n<p>Lewis comes from a Jewish background and it is not until the fifth poem, <em>Once,<\/em> that we learn that his brother Jason had been adopted. Born to an Italian mother, Jason is brought into the Lewis household by Lewis\u2019s grandmother.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><em>\u2026Once upon a time, it\u2019s true,<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>the mother and brother, a pair,<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>looking out, a long wait<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>for the new baby to get there\u2026<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>I\u2019m your brother, and, so I\u2019m\u2026<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Too long upon this time.<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>The poems are dark yet also uplifting because of their honesty. Lewis never tries to excuse his brother or to make excuses for himself in how he responds to addiction. This collection gives readers permission to confront their own demons and to write about them. No one is going to judge us or our reactions. Lewis has shown us how to do it. He has not abandoned his brother but is still talking to him after thirty years. Jason still has a prominent place in Lewis\u2019s life\u00a0and he listens to what his brother may be saying to him from beyond the grave. Lewis is working through his own feelings and is trying to make sense of his inexplicable loss. He never once blames his brother as an adopted force that came into the family, but fully accepts that Jason is his brother, and that he died at the age of twenty three.<\/p>\n<p>The poems are beautifully constructed and restrained. They explore the chaos that addiction can bring to a family. Jason\u2019s girlfriend, also hooked on heroine, is behind\u00a0some of the late night frantic phone calls that Jason makes to Lewis. I have the feeling that Lewis helped to sort out the chaos that still existed in his mind about his brother\u2019s death by writing this elegy. It seems that Lewis\u2019s second marriage to Susan was the catalyst for this\u00a0collection. He wanted to introduce Susan to Jason, and vice versa. In the poem<em> Introducing,<\/em> Lewis writes:<\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Under the chuppah<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>The rabbi will call: Yaacov ben Simcha\u2026<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>You\u2019ll ride on my shoulder \u2013<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Best man!<\/em><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>These poems are compassionate:<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><em>And what of the family\u2019s soul,<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Mother, as if you already knew <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>his disquieted soul won\u2019t find peace\u2026<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>ruthless:<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><em>Your breath is foul from rotten<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>meat. Your nostrils flare me <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>fresh in the cave of your furry hug.<\/em><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>nostalgic:<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><em>Remember how each year<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>we\u2019d come back, have to learn<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>the beach all over again?<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>confused:<\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u2026 you don\u2019t know how <\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>you passed a bill to the cashier<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>or how she passed you change<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>and why she is smiling or how<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>your hand cold lift the cup\u2026<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>angry:<\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Okay brother,<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>Give me what you got.<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>A kick to the solar plexus.<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>full of searching:<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><em>This morning, the hour of haze,<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>a blackbird called through my window<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>with some urgency. (I think it was you.)<\/em><\/p>\n<p><em>\u00a0<\/em><\/p>\n<p>This fine collection\u00a0would be very helpful for any family involved with a loved one going down the addiction route. The poems are energetic and the energy released will speak to many who are trying to understand this destructive path. The poems could act as a personal counsellor by offering the different stages of grief. Each reader can\u00a0digest the content at his or her own individual pace.<\/p>\n<p>The book would also be a useful teaching tool in the narrative medicine field as it demonstrates how personal stories paint a lucid and detailed understanding of the subject.<\/p>\n<p>But first and foremost it is a book of poems that Owen Lewis has dedicated to his younger brother who died at the age of twenty three while hooked on drugs. The poems reflect a tragic story of a young life wasted.<\/p>\n<p><em>Best Man<\/em>\u00a0should be widely read as these fine poems hit hard upon the dormant tragedy in all of us that perhaps\u00a0looms around the corner. Lewis&#8217;s work depicts an\u00a0unsettled world that is within each of us. From the outset,\u00a0we realise that\u00a0we are not in for an easy read.<\/p>\n<p>A\u00a0finely produced book, <em>Best Man<\/em> has an arresting cover depicting youth, confusion, and the beauty of snowdrops that\u00a0appear in a touching poem, <em>Thaw.<\/em><\/p>\n<p>I hope that for Owen Lewis the thaw has begun with the publication of this work.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>Wendy French<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/wendyfrench.co.uk\">wendyfrench.co.uk<\/a><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>Wendy French,<em> Thinks Itself A Hawk,<\/em> poems from UCH Macmillan Cancer Centre.
